1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What type of triangles can we apply the Pythagorean theorem to?

Back

Right triangles.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the relationship between the sides of a right triangle according to the Pythagorean theorem?

Back

The square of the length of the hypotenuse is equal to the sum of the squares of the lengths of the other two sides.
